Manijanga

Manijanga is a village located in Nimapada tehsil of Puri district in Odisha,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Nimapada (tehsildar office) and 53km away from district headquarter Puri. As per 2009 stats, Alanda is the gram panchayat of Manijanga village.

About Manijanga

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Manijanga is 408959. The village spans a total geographical area of 212 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 752114. Bhubaneswar is nearest town to Manijanga village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 33km away.

Population of Manijanga

Below is a concise population overview of Manijanga as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,281 617 664
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 125 60 65
Scheduled Castes (SC) 240 127 113
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 1 1 N/A
Literate Population 1,006 515 491
Illiterate Population 275 102 173

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Manijanga village:

  • The total population of Manijanga village is around 1,281, including approximately 617 males and 664 females, with a sex ratio of 1076 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 125 children aged 0–6 years in Manijanga village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Manijanga village has 240 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 1 person from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Manijanga village is about 78.53%, with male literacy at 83.47% and female literacy at 73.95%.
  • There are around 340 households in Manijanga village.

Connectivity of Manijanga

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Manijanga. As per the 2011 stats, Manijanga had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
